Body Builders

293)  I have discovered when I am discouraged, depressed or feeling all-around useless, all I have to do is build others up. In focusing on someone else, I have found that what I gain is exactly what I felt I needed in the first place. 1 Thessalonians 5:19

Action Figure

292) Trust only comes as a result of knowing another. If you don’t really know someone, it’s prudent to reserve trust. God IS trust-worthy and the more you get to know Him, the easier it is to trust that He will act with your best in mind, constantly.  Psalm 37:5

In Training

289) It is good to get into a habit of training. Exercise accomplishes so much that is good for us. In addition, spiritual training helps us not only on this Earth but in the life to come. Are you in training? 1 Timothy 4:8
